United States - Import of Pig and Poultry Fat

Since 2014, United States Import of Pig and Poultry Fat grew 10.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 27 among other countries in Import of Pig and Poultry Fat with $6,156,286. United States is overtaken by Lithuania, which was ranked number 26 with $6,193,622.79 and is followed by Serbia with $5,768,236. Japan ranked the highest with $77,494,064 in 2019, that is +15.5% compared to 2018. Philippines, Mexico and Ukraine resp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Nepal witnessed the best average annual growth at +79% per year, while Bahrain witnessed the worst performance at -63.5% per year.
